Never seen him play but watched highlight videos (which we know can make anyone look good). That said I think it’s a shrewd signing. At worst he’s back up for Porro and Bissouma, at best he is our first choice DM. Looks to be comfortable on the ball, can beat a press, head up and positive, looks to go forward, and a good tackler. Being home grown, young and shifting deadwood in Rodon means it could be a great signing. Bring in Eze next Baldy.
 
£25m + Joe Rodon is actually a solid bit of business.

I do like deals that get done quickly - 48 hours ago it seemed very likely that the possibility of us signing him had gone, so its gone from 'no chance' to done bar the signing in about 24 hours.
 

It's believed that Brentford had initially offered over his release clause to get a deal done quickly and he was even set to undergo a medical.

But it was shot down over issues with the payment structure.

Leeds academy product Gray had been offered a contract worth £75,000-a-week, an attractive package for the 18-year-old.
 
Bit of detail in here.


Daniel Levy is understood to have agreed to United’s payment terms and should pocket the Whites a guaranteed £40m, although the breakdown of instalments is unclear. It is understood Brentford and Spurs had each activated that clause, though only the latter met United’s demands on structure

Maybe.

But I think the real deal clincher for Leeds will have been the opportunity to sign Rodon permanently as he was a real rock in their defence last season - and for only £10m which is probably a bargain as he's good enough for lower PL so covers them on promotion and probably 'worth' anything up to £20m to them so its a hidden upside of £5m+.

With Rodon back at Leeds it means they've only lost one member (Gray) of a very good side, and have got £25m to spend which could buy two or more good players in Championship.

So I think the deal is a 'win' for both clubs !
